Eavestrough Clearing in Long Island, NY
Eavestrough clearing services involve removing leaves, debris, and blockages from the gutters surrounding a property’s roof. This maintenance helps ensure that rainwater flows properly through the gutters and downspouts, preventing water from overflowing and causing potential damage to the roof, siding, foundation, or landscaping. Projects typically include routine cleanings for residential homes, especially in areas with many trees, as well as preparations for seasonal storms or after heavy winds. Homeowners often seek this service to protect their property’s structural integrity and avoid costly repairs caused by water intrusion or pooling.
Before requesting eavestrough clearing, property owners should consider the size and accessibility of their gutters, as well as any specific concerns about overflowing or blockages. It’s helpful to identify if there are areas prone to clogging or if there has been recent storm damage. Understanding the scope of the project, such as whether gutter guards are installed or if repairs are needed, can assist in planning the service. Properly maintaining clear gutters is an essential part of home upkeep, especially in regions prone to heavy seasonal rainfall.

Eavestrough Clearing Questions
Why is eavestrough clearing important? Regular clearing helps prevent water damage, foundation issues, and basement flooding by ensuring proper drainage away from the property.
How often should eavestroughs be cleaned? It is recommended to clean eavestroughs at least twice a year, typically in spring and fall, or more frequently if there are many trees nearby.
What signs indicate eavestroughs need cleaning? Signs include overflowing water, sagging gutters, visible debris, or water pooling around the foundation.
Can eavestroughs be cleaned without professional tools? While some homeowners may attempt cleaning with basic tools, professional services use specialized equipment for thorough and safe clearing.
